정구리의 우주정복
[Docker] Docker 환경에 Postgresql 설치하기 (Docker compose 로 설치) 본문
반응형
저번에 Keycloak 을 띄웠다면 이번에는 Postgresql 을 띄워보겠다 !
docker-compose.yml 작성
version: '3.8'
services:
keyclaok:
image: quay.io/keycloak/keycloak:24.0.3
ports:
- "3000:8080"
environment:
- KEYCLOAK_ADMIN=admin
- KEYCLOAK_ADMIN_PASSWORD=admin
command: ["start-dev"]
postgresql:
image: postgres:16
ports:
- "3100:5432"
environment:
- POSTGRES_PASSWORD=admin
- POSTGRES_USER=admin
- POSTGRES_DB=jungry_postgresql
이렇게 저번 포스팅에 작성한 docker-compose.yml 하위에 postgresql 에 대한 정보를 추가했다 !
postgresql Docker hub
여기에서 버전 정보 쇼핑 했는데 나는 16버전 써보고 싶어서 image 의 버전은 16으로 해줬다
docker compose 를 통해 install
jungry@jungry-MacBook-Pro jungry % docker-compose up postgresql
해당 명령어를 실행해주면
설치가 완료된다
실제 연결 테스트를 해보면 정상적으로 연결되는 것을 확인할 수 있다 !
반응형
'JAVA > PROJECT' 카테고리의 다른 글
Comments